Chief Advisor expresses condolences over plane crash in India

Professor Dr. Muhammad Yunus, Chief Advisor to the Interim Government of Bangladesh, has expressed deep grief over the plane crash in Ahmedabad, India.

In a condolence message sent to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Thursday (June 12, 2025), he wrote, “I am deeply saddened by the tragic news of the crash of an Air India Boeing 787-8 Dreamliner carrying 242 passengers in Ahmedabad. My deepest condolences to the families who lost their loved ones in this tragic incident.”

The Chief Advisor said, “In this difficult time, our thoughts and prayers are with the victims of the accident and their loved ones. We stand with the people and government of India. We are ready to provide all kinds of assistance if needed.
